Land grading services involve the careful reshaping and leveling of a property's land to create a stable and even surface. This process typically includes removing excess soil, filling in low spots, and contouring the land to achieve the desired slope and drainage pattern. Proper land grading ensures that water flows away from structures, preventing pooling and reducing the risk of foundation issues. It often involves the use of specialized equipment to achieve precise results that support the long-term stability and usability of the property.

One of the primary problems land grading addresses is poor drainage, which can lead to water accumulation, erosion, and damage to landscaping or structures. Inadequate grading can cause water to collect around foundations, leading to potential flooding or structural deterioration over time. Additionally, uneven terrain can make landscaping, construction, or recreational activities more difficult or unsafe. By improving the land’s slope and surface, grading services help mitigate these issues and promote proper water runoff, reducing the likelihood of water-related property damage.

Properties that commonly utilize land grading services include residential homes, commercial developments, and agricultural land. Residential properties often require grading to prepare a yard for landscaping, install driveways, or establish proper drainage around the home. Commercial sites benefit from grading to create stable foundations for buildings, parking lots, and outdoor amenities. Agricultural properties may need grading to improve irrigation efficiency or to prevent soil erosion. The overview below groups typical Land Grading proj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hermitage,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Basic Land Grading - Typically costs between $1,000 and $3,000 for small residential projects. This includes leveling yards or minor slope adjustments for drainage. Costs vary based on the size and complexity of the area.

Standard Land Grading - Usually ranges from $3,000 to $7,000 for larger residential properties. This covers more extensive grading to prepare land for construction or landscaping. Example projects may include driveway grading or foundation preparation.

Heavy Land Grading - Can range from $7,000 to $15,000 or more for large-scale or commercial sites. This involves significant excavation, slope shaping, and site preparation. Costs depend on land size and the extent of earthmoving required.

Additional Costs - Extra charges may apply for tree removal, soil stabilization, or complex drainage systems. These services can add several hundred to thousands of dollars to the overall project cost, depending on site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is land grading? Land grading involves leveling or shaping the ground surface to ensure proper drainage and prepare the site for construction or landscaping projects.

Why is land grading important? Proper land grading helps prevent water accumulation, reduces erosion, and creates a stable foundation for structures and landscaping.

How do I find local land grading professionals? Contacting local contractors or service providers specializing in land grading can connect property owners with experienced professionals in Hermitage, TN, and nearby areas.

What factors influence the cost of land grading? The size of the area, soil condition, and complexity of the grading work can affect the overall cost, which can be discussed with local service providers.

Are permits required for land grading? Permit requirements vary by location; consulting with local contractors or authorities can provide guidance on necessary permissions for land grading projects.
